Recommendations for Improving Casino Performance

As we examine the current state of casino performance, it becomes apparent that focused strategies can greatly boost memory efficiency and overall user experience.

First, we should implement adaptive resource allocation that dynamically adjusts based on user activity and peak times. This ensures smoother performance and less memory strain.

Next, improving game assets—such as compressing textures and refining animations—can notably reduce memory usage without sacrificing graphical integrity.

Utilizing modern programming frameworks that support robust garbage collection is another crucial step. This stops memory leaks and assists maintain peak performance during prolonged gameplay.

Lastly, we suggest periodic performance audits employing data analytics to find bottlenecks. By analyzing user engagement and memory consumption patterns, we can make well-founded adjustments that boost both performance and user satisfaction.
